The Psychology of Parasocial Relationships
Modern technology has fostered the growth of parasocial relationships, where fans feel a deep, one sided emotional connection with a celebrity they have never met. This phenomenon is amplified by the constant stream of personal updates provided through digital channels, creating an illusion of intimacy that can drive immense commercial success. Brands leverage these connections to market products, knowing that a recommendation from a trusted public figure carries more weight than a traditional advertisement in the current market.

The Influence of Global Trends on Local Content
Cultural exchange has reached an unprecedented level of velocity, with trends from one side of the world manifesting in another within a matter of hours. The global popularity of non English language media, such as Korean dramas or Spanish thrillers, proves that audiences are more willing than ever to step outside their linguistic comfort zones for a compelling story. This globalization of taste has forced local producers to think more broadly, incorporating international elements into their work to attract a more diverse viewership.
This cross pollination not only enriches the content but also fosters a greater sense of global empathy, as viewers are exposed to different societal structures and cultural nuances. The ability to access a vast array of international entertainment through a single digital portal has transformed the way we perceive the world, making the distant feel familiar. As a result, the definition of a hit show or a chart topping song is no longer confined to a single country but is determined by a global network of listeners and viewers.
The Digital Echo Chamber Effect
While the availability of global content is a positive development, the nature of digital algorithms can sometimes create echo chambers that limit exposure to truly diverse perspectives. Users are often fed content that aligns with their previous preferences, which can inadvertently narrow their cultural horizons even as the world becomes more connected. Breaking through these digital walls requires a conscious effort to seek out unfamiliar genres and voices, challenging the predictive nature of the software.
The struggle against the algorithm is a central theme in the modern consumption of media, where the goal is to find a balance between personalized recommendations and serendipitous discovery. When a user explores a broad category, they are more likely to encounter stories that challenge their assumptions and expand their understanding of the human experience. This intellectual curiosity is what keeps the entertainment industry vibrant and prevents it from stagnating into a cycle of repetitive tropes and clichés.

Ethics in the Age of Artificial Intelligence
The integration of artificial intelligence into the creative process has sparked a significant debate regarding the nature of authorship and the value of human intuition. AI is now capable of generating scripts, composing music, and creating stunning visual art, leading to concerns that the human element of storytelling may be diminished. However, many creators view these tools as collaborators that can handle the technical aspects of production, leaving the human artist free to focus on the emotional and conceptual core of the work.
The ethical implications of AI in entertainment extend to the use of deepfake technology and the digital resurrection of deceased performers, raising questions about consent and the sanctity of a person's image. As these tools become more accessible, the industry must establish a framework for their use to prevent deception and protect the rights of creators. The ongoing conversation about AI is not just about technology but about what it means to be a creator in a world where the machine can mimic the master.
